Visualizzazione dei risultati da 1 a 8 su 8

Discussione: [VB6] Funzioni Stringa

  1. #1
    Utente di HTML.it L'avatar di Fado84
    Registrato dal
    Feb 2004
    Messaggi
    347

    [VB6] Funzioni Stringa

    salve a tutti, ho un piccolissimo problema..
    vado al dunque..
    ho più stringhe fatte in questo modo:

    ><?!54 !"£$FSAF
    SD"£!"2 £$FSA
    "EAD£$312 "£"D

    di queste stringhe volevo tenere solo i numeri quindi come dall'esempio sopra:

    ><?!54 !"£$FSAF >>> 54
    SD"£!"2 £$FSA >>> 5
    "EAD£$312 "£"D >>> 312

    grazie mille per l'aiuto
    ciao

  2. #2
    codice:
    stemp = ""
    for i = 1 to len(stringa)
       if isnumeric(mid$(stringa,i,1)) then
          stemp = stemp & mid$(stringa,i,1)
       end if
    next i
    dentro stemp hai tutti i numeri che ci sono nella stringa
    Vascello fantasma dei mentecatti nonchè baronetto della scara corona alcolica, piccolo spuccello di pezza dislessico e ubriaco- Colui che ha modificato l'orribile scritta - Gran Evacuatore Mentecatto - Tristo Mietitore Mentecatto chi usa uTonter danneggia anche te

  3. #3
    Utente di HTML.it L'avatar di Fado84
    Registrato dal
    Feb 2004
    Messaggi
    347
    grazie.. era una banalità mi vergogno di me stesso.. sarà perchè era l'1.
    ciao e grazie

  4. #4
    Utente di HTML.it L'avatar di Fado84
    Registrato dal
    Feb 2004
    Messaggi
    347
    scusa.. non capisco una cosa.. cosa cambia da
    mid$ a mid ??
    grazie

  5. #5
    Utente di HTML.it L'avatar di Fado84
    Registrato dal
    Feb 2004
    Messaggi
    347
    aiuto, che casino per una cavolata..
    devo avere una condizione di questo tipo:
    codice:
    If (IsNumeric(Mid$(stringa, i, 1)) Or Mid$(stringa, i, 1) = ".") And (Mid$(stringa, i + 1, 1) <> """ ) Then
    praticamente voglio che mi scarti quei numeri a cui segue un apice...
    ciao!

  6. #6
    Utente di HTML.it L'avatar di Fado84
    Registrato dal
    Feb 2004
    Messaggi
    347
    ho risolto con Chr(34)

    ciao

  7. #7
    Utente di HTML.it L'avatar di Toeke
    Registrato dal
    Aug 2002
    Messaggi
    348
    Originariamente inviato da Fado84
    scusa.. non capisco una cosa.. cosa cambia da
    mid$ a mid ??
    grazie
    L'uso del $ e' un modo per definire una variabile
    $ = String
    % = Integer
    & = Long
    Etc.

    Una variabile dichiarata cosi:

    codice:
    dim i as integer
    o
    codice:
    dim i%
    e' la stessa cosa.
    Nel caso delle funzioni e' + o meno la stessa cosa.


    Toeke

  8. #8
    Utente di HTML.it L'avatar di Fado84
    Registrato dal
    Feb 2004
    Messaggi
    347
    altro problemuccio..
    se ho una stringa di 1000 caratteri come faccio a cancellare dal carattere 0 al 100 ??
    e dal 253 al 278 e dal 500 al 999??

    Grazie mille!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
    saluti

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.